ong announced as the epicentre for the American jewelry trade, the JCK Show in Las Vegas is realigning its focus on the world of horology with its upcoming event in 2026. Introducing the initiative ‘Timepieces’, the organizers aim to create an enthralling industry platform that transcends its repute as a fringe category.
Slated to kick off from May 29th–June 1st, with an exclusive opening for Luxury by invitation, the 2026 show is set to go beyond just adding more exhibitors. It is about fostering education and nurturing a sense of community, with a special spotlight on watch culture, facilitated through partnerships and programs of high distinction.
The Fondation Haute Horlogerie (FHH) is set to make a significant contribution to the event with its dedication to horology education. Known for its global custodianship of watchmaking culture, the FHH plans to deliver educational sessions aimed at retailers, spotlighting the essence of exceptional watch crafting.
Collaborating with event partners such as RedBar Group and American Watchmakers-Clockmakers Institute, JCK offers an enriched experience that encompasses collectors’ meetups, high-level networking opportunities, hands-on technical training, and a plethora of panel discussions.
The JCK seeks not only to scale but also to narrate the stories behind the watches, combining a selective brand participation, institutional knowledge, and technical expertise to offer a unique experience that truly appreciates the diversity of horological artistry.
